JOB TITLE: EARLY CHILDHOOD SPEECH-LANGUAGE PATHOLOGIST – FAMILY-CENTERED PEDIATRIC CARE LOCATION: METRO ATLANTA AREA: LAWRENCEVILLE / PEACHTREE CORNERS / LOGANVILLE, GA TIME ZONE: EASTERN TIME (ET) ROLE OVERVIEW We’re seeking a pediatric SLP with a passion for early communication development and family partnership. You’ll support children’s speech and language growth through thoughtful assessment, individualized therapy, and caregiver coaching—supported by strong mentorship, collaboration, and a steady flow of referrals.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Complete pediatric evaluations and translate results into actionable treatment goals
  • Provide therapy targeting early language, articulation, phonological processes, and pragmatic skills
  • Coach caregivers on strategies to support progress between sessions
  • Track progress and adjust plans using data and clinical judgement
  • Maintain clear, timely notes and progress reports
  • Collaborate with supervisors and team members through ongoing case discussion
  • Create a warm, encouraging environment for children and families RE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Master’s degree in Speech-Language Pathology
  • Current SLP licensure or CF eligibility (CF and CCC-SLP welcome)
  • Strong interpersonal skills and comfort working directly with families/caregivers
  • Ability to manage sessions, documentation, and scheduling with professionalism
  • Authorized to work in the United States P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Experience with toddler/preschool populations and play-based therapy
  • Exposure to AAC (low-tech/high-tech) and caregiver training
  • Interest in continuing education and clinical growth pathways TOOLS & TECHNOLOGY
  • Electronic documentation system and digital scheduling tools
  • Video platforms for team meetings, supervision, and telepractice when needed
